The 2025-26 Marquette women’s basketball season came to an end on Selection Sunday when the Golden Eagles were not included in the WBIT or the WNIT fields. That means MU’s last game of the year was actually back on March 7, when they lost 57-44 to Creighton in the quarterfinals of the Big East tournament. […]

On Sunday, March 1st, Marquette women’s basketball ended the regular season with a 69-65 road win over Providence. On Saturday, March 7th, Marquette women’s basketball ended their run in the Big East tournament after just one game, falling 57-44 to Creighton in the quarterfinals.
